SubjectRe: [RFC] Device Tree Overlays Proposal (Was Re: capebus moving omap_devices to mach-omap2)
On Wed, Nov 7, 2012 at 11:02 AM, Pantelis Antoniou
<panto@antoniou-consulting.com> wrote:
> On Nov 7, 2012, at 11:19 AM, Benoit Cousson wrote:
>> Maybe some extra version match table can just be passed during the board machine_init
>>
>> of_platform_populate(NULL, omap_dt_match_table, NULL, NULL, panda_version_match_table);
>>
>
> Would we need explicit of_platform_populate calls if we have node modification notifiers?
> In that case the notifier would pick it up automatically, and can do the per
> version matching internally.

There still needs to be something to register "everything below this
node is interesting" which is exactly what of_platform_populate() does
now. I see the notifiers being used by the of_platform_populate
backend to know when nodes have been created (or destroyed).
